Why is a cooling system necessary for a 1.5 kW LED?
High-power LEDs like 1.5 kW generate immense heat that can damage the diode or reduce efficiency without active cooling; the YouTuber's design addresses this to enable sustained operation at such intensities, unlike low-power LEDs in standard flashlights.
